Attention itself is ultimately a motor phenomenon. Thus: the
sensory aspect of attention is vividness, and vividness is
explained physiologically as a brain-state of readiness for motor
discharge;<1> in the case of a visual stimulus, for instance, a
state of readiness to carry out movements of adjustment to the
object; in short, the motor path is open. Now attention, or
vividness, is found to fluctuate periodically, so that in a
series of objectively equal stimuli, certain ones, regularly
recurring, would be more vividly sensed. This is exemplified
in the well-known facts of the fluctuation of the threshold of
sensation, of the so-called retinal rivalry, and of the subjective
rhythmizing of auditory stimuli, already mentioned. There is a
natural rhythm of vividness. Here, therefore, in the very
conditions of consciousness itself, we have the conditions of
rhythm too. The case of subjective motor rhythm would be still
clearer, since vividness is only the psychical side of readiness
for motor discharge; in other words, increased readiness for
motor discharge occurs periodically, giving motor rhythm.

It has been said<1> that this periodicity of the brain-wave
cannot furnish the necessary condition for rhythm, inasmuch as
it is itself a constant, and could at most be applied to a series
which was adapted to its own time. But this objection does not
fit the facts. The "brain-wave," or "vividness," or attention
period, is not a constant, but attaches itself to the contents
of consciousness. In other words, it does not function without
material. It is itself conditioned by its occasion. In the
case of a regularly repeated stimulus, it is simply adjusted
to what is there, and out of the series chooses, as it were,
one at regular periods.<2>
